Our guest for today is none other than Libi Phillips, a true embodiment of Welsh pride and inspiration. Libi has not only excelled as a para-athlete but has also had the honour of representing Wales as a Captain. Join James and Libi as they explore the thrilling journey of representing Wales on the international stage, the challenges she has overcome, and the unwavering pride she feels for her home country. Tune in to this episode for an enlightening conversation with Libi Phillips and get ready to be inspired by the pride, passion, and unity that drives the world of disability sports in Wales. This episode was recorded as part of the Disability Sport Wales Disabled Young Leaders in Sport Inspiring Connections Event, that took place at the iconic Tramshed Cardiff.
